Transaction d23795502ea596cbb1508e23a24062fd61ecc44142aaeb80b505721cfd6c1eab
1 Input
1 Output
-
d23795502ea596cbb1508e23a24062fd61ecc44142aaeb80b505721cfd6c1eab:0
- value
- 70357284
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b437f341ae8f8bd82e0099ef8ec8df28a0b8833 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14wkv1reohRk6iUmRXyYrX8CBrbZBusSiN